Does Wyoming get hail?

December 14, 2021 by Bridget Gibson

Cheyenne Pummeled With Hail; Wyoming One of the Most Hailed-On States In Country.These states meet in an area known as “hail alley” and average seven to nine hail days per year. Claycomb said early June is a prime time for severe storms in southeast Wyoming.

What city in the US gets the most hail?

Insurance companies have dubbed the area where Colorado, Wyoming and Nebraska meet as “Hail Alley.” National Weather Service statistics indicate Cheyenne, Wyoming, with an average of nine days of hail per year, as the “hail capital” of the United States.

What states are in hail alley?

A triangular region that extends from “southwest Texas, northeastward to northwest Missouri, then northwestward into western South Dakota, and finally down the Front Range of the Rocky Mountains, into eastern New Mexico and west Texas” is known as “Hail Alley”.

Does Colorado get a lot of hail?

Colorado, along with Nebraska, Wyoming, and Texas, form hail alley, the world’s most hailed-up region. In terms of insured damages, Colorado is second only to Texas. Over the past decade, insurers have covered $5 billion in hail damage in Colorado alone.

What time of year is hail most common?

spring
Although spring brings the highest chance for hailstorms throughout the year, autumn brings a secondary, smaller peak in hailstorms. “There is also a second brief ‘hail season’ in the early fall as air [higher in the atmosphere] cools back down, but heat and moisture at the surface are still quite high,” Clark said.

How do you know when hail is coming?

Hail can be detected using radar. On Doppler radar, hail generally sends a return signal that looks like extremely heavy rainfall. Dual-polarization radar technology, used by the NWS, can help tell the difference between hail, ice pellets and rain, and even determine hail size.

Where is hail alley in Colorado?

Colorado is typically known for bad hail storms due to the fact that the Front Range is located in what is known as the second “Hail Alley”. The first Hail Alley is in the Central Plains. However, from the Denver Metro area to Colorado Springs, it gets an average of 13 large hail events per year.

Why is hail so bad in Colorado?

One reason we are so prone to hail is our altitude. Because Colorado has such a high average elevation we are closer to the freezing level in the atmosphere. This allows strong updrafts to reach the hail producing region of a cloud.

What size hail does damage to cars?

“Testing and observations have shown that the threshold size for hail to dent a steel vehicle body panel is hard ice that is one inch in diameter. Softer aluminum panels and bright metal trim material may be dented by hard ice that is one-half inch in diameter”, according to National Underwriter Property & Casualty.

Why is there no lightning in Hawaii?

The very warm and tropical maritime climate keeps the atmosphere over Hawaii stable most of the year. For severe weather to occur, a strong low-pressure system is necessary to generate instability and comes around only once in a great while.

Why does it rain so much in Kauai?

Persistent easterly trade winds bring substantial moisture from the ocean against Kauai’s steep mountainsides. As for Mt. Waialeale, the steep cliffs cause the moisture-laden air to rise rapidly, then dump a large portion of rain in one spot.
